It has somewhat gone out of style. People are growing more interested in XYZ dragons, especially with the amount of genes that have accent colors now. People are finding new ways to match primaries and secondaries.
Plus the general over-abundance of dragons means that most kinds of dragons can probably be snapped up for fodder price at some point.

It depends on the color of XXX. The colors from the original color wheel have been bred out for so long that there are many more of them then the demand for them calls for. Some of the newer colors like pearl are still relatively pricey if you want XXX's in gem genes and rare breeds.
